Welcome to a brand new episode of the ¿Quién Tú Eres? podcast, where we explore the conflict we often face between "professionalism" & being our authentic selves. This week's guest is Rachel Lowenstein.

Rachel is the Global Head of Inclusive Innovation at Mindshare, leading strategy and innovation for how brands use marketing, media, and technology to reshape society for good. A respected industry thought leader, Rachel has worked with some of the biggest brands in the world, including Unilever and Booking.com. As an autistic woman, Rachel is a content creator on TikTok, LinkedIn, and Instagram to educate and advocate for neuroinclusion. Rachel has over 90,000 people in her community across platforms because of her unique perspectives as a creative leader who is autistic.

In this eye-opening episode, we dive into Rachel's incredible journey of self-discovery, as she shares how her autism diagnosis became a catalyst for improving her mental well-being and unleashing her creativity in the workplace. Before receiving her diagnosis, Rachel grappled with a challenging concept known as "masking," commonly experienced by autistic individuals. She felt compelled to hide her true traits or behaviors to fit into society's mold of being "neurotypical," leading to feelings of being misunderstood and overstimulated by societal pressures to be constantly available.

However, everything changed after her diagnosis. Armed with the knowledge of her condition, Rachel realized that she wasn't "crazy" for feeling the way she did. This newfound understanding empowered her to embrace her authentic self and unapologetically express her unique qualities. Now, she passionately helps others in the workplace and their daily lives to embrace their true selves, fostering a culture of acceptance and inclusivity.

Our mission is to redefine the word "professionalism" by empowering Latino/ Latina/ Latinx communities to be their authentic selves. When we are told to be professional, in many ways we are told to not be ourselves. On this podcast, we have candid conversations and explore the conflict that we often face between being our authentic selves & "professionalism". The podcast is named ¿Quién Tú Eres? because that’s the question that we want each guest to answer. Listen to find out who we really are...when we stop code-switching.
